What happens when a governor grants parole?

Sagot :

Answer:

In rare occasions, a Texas governor can grant a 30-day reprieve in death penalty cases. Before the 1934 constitutional amendment, the governor had independent pardon powers. However, after Jim and Miriam Ferguson were accused of selling clemency during the latter's term, an amendment was added to remove independent pardon powers.
